iio: core: introduce iio_device_{claim|release}_buffer_mode() APIs
These APIs are analogous to iio_device_claim_direct_mode() and iio_device_release_direct_mode() but, as the name suggests, with the logic flipped. While this looks odd enough, it will have at least two users (in following changes) and it will be important to move the IIO mlock to the private struct.
